Troubleshooting your Dyson
Problem Potential solution
Less than normal or no pickup If vacuuming non-delicate carpeting, ensure brush control is
from cleanerhead or set on carpets mode. Note: brushbar will only spin when the
handle is reclined.
Machine turns off in use
Remove and check washable filter to see if it is clean (filter
should be blue in color). Wash filter if necessary as shown
on page 8.
If you removed the soleplate, it must be refitted flush with the
cleanerhead. If it is not, refit soleplate as shown on page 15
and re-check performance.
Be sure the filter housing, U-bend, and airway inspection valve
are snapped in securely and confirm there are no blockages.
Less than normal or no suction Confirm the U-bend is in place and that there are no blockages.
from wand or hose
Remove the wand and check for blockages.
Confirm the hose has no blockages or holes by stretching it out.
Be sure the filter housing and airway inspection valve are
snapped in securely and confirm there are no blockages.
Remove and check washable filter to see if it is clean (filter
should be blue in color). Wash filter if necessary as shown
on page 8.
Brushbar not spinning Ensure brush control is set on carpets mode.
Note: brushbar will only spin when the handle is reclined.
Loud ‘ratcheting’ noise coming Ratcheting may indicate there is an obstruction in the brushbar
from cleanerhead when and is meant to protect the belt in the machine. Note: the
vacuuming ratcheting may also occur if your carpet is not adequately
attached to the floor or if your rug has loose tassels. (This noise
does not hurt the machine.)
Check to see if there is an obstruction in the brushbar as shown
on page 15.
Note: when refitting the soleplate it must be fitted securely.
Affix as shown on page 15.
If there is no obstruction, you may want to set brush control
to bare floors mode.
Unit will not stand upright Stand behind the vacuum holding the handle at a 45
degree angle.
Locate and remove the airway inspection valve and take note
of the square plastic molding where the airway inspection valve
plugs into. (It should slide up and down.)
Snap that square plastic piece up toward the ceiling.
After it snaps into place, the unit will stand upright.
